Job Description:
The primary duty of the Real Estate program associate is to review grant records received from the US Fish and Wildlife Service and compare land acquisition costs, cost allocations, acreages and other grant information to ensure consistency in reporting in the DNR Land Records System. The program associate will compare records, highlight inconsistencies, record errors and log correction codes to the LRS database.
The Real Estate Program Associate will work closely with the Real Estate Land Records Officer until competency is displayed in records research, after which general supervision will suffice. Competency will be demonstrated through sound judgment displayed by the program associate in database reconciliation decisions and reporting. Frequent updates between Land Records Officer and Real Estate Program Associate are required to monitor quality of work and project progress.
Duties & Responsibilities:
- Review and document inconsistencies in federal interest records. (60%)
- Order and research paper files from state records center. (30%)
- Initiate communications and collaborate with related programs (5%)
- Other research related duties as assigned (5%)
